Set in the heart of Wereham, Norfolk sits this charming and truly remarkable property that is both old school and characterful. This unique find is a rare gem that combines vintage charm with comfortable living, making it the perfect blend of old and new.


Welcome to The Old School. Dating back to 1876, this property offers a nurturing appeal and remains a focal point of the village having been the local school for many years. As you step foot inside, the abundance of space, elegant interior, and functionality become very apparent.


There are three sizeable reception rooms, including the kitchen-diner, accompanied by a well-appointed shower room, cloakroom, under stair walk-in storage room, and a substantial utility room. As you explore, the array of original features and thoughtful additions merge seamlessly, offering a characterful canvas to make your own.


The first floor currently offers three double bedrooms, one with ensuite, and a family bathroom off-landing. Bedroom one and two boast floor to ceiling windows for plenty of natural daylight and fabulous views. Bedroom two had at one stage been two separate bedrooms, offering versatility for a fourth bedroom if desired.


Now for the great outdoors. The garden is beautifully enclosed with an original wall on one side and mature hedge on the other. At the end of the lawned garden there is a characterful store as part of the original build, with an adjacent workshop / garage / studio / office leading out onto an enclosed patio to the other side. This framework lends itself to many uses including an annexe.


Wereham is a friendly village positioned only a 12-minute drive east of the reputable market town of Downham Market where most daily amenities and eateries are catered for. In addition, Waitrose in Swaffham is only a 20-minute drive. Village life here is tranquil with access to acres of rural walks within moments of the doorstep.
